A young Christian Khmu leader, Miss Kh, was doing an outreach with the girls who are working at the various sewing companies in a Lao city. She and her co-workers' main job was to do the visitation and give encouragement to the brand new Christians. She also did evangelism and discipleship training as well. During 2 months she was able to lead 2 girls to Jesus Christ. She visited the girls at noon time during their break for lunch. She was encouraged to find that the girls were waiting for them to visit and pray together.

 

The young people love to come to the Bible study and learn Khmu songs on Saturdays. Some of them stay overnight in the Khmu home and some return to the companies for the night. They started giving an offering for to help the ministry cost.  Praise God!

 

In May there was a special night when about 90 came to the Khmu house church on Saturday. It was a joyful and exciting time, and also many of them stayed there overnight. Miss Kh said that the head of the village had not expressed any complaint for the activities. Earlier in May the authorities ordered them to close their house church. But now they are holding worship service again at night time but not on Sunday morning as before. Please pray for them!
